Proper name [English]

IPA: /ˈɹiːʃn̩/ [UK], /ˈɹiːʃɪən/ [UK]
Etymology: From Rhaetia + -an. Etymology templates: {{suffix|en|Rhaetia|an}} Rhaetia + -an Head templates: {{en-proper noun}} Rhaetian
  1. (linguistics) An extinct non-Romance language spoken in the ancient region of Raetia in the eastern Alps in pre-Roman and Roman times. Categories (topical): Linguistics, Extinct languages Related terms (Linguist list entry for): xrr
